CloudHub是MuleSoft提供的云集成平台,用于快速构建、部署和管理应用程序。502错误通常表示网关错误,指示客户端尝试与服务器通信时出现了问题。在CloudHub部署的过程中,如果出现502错误,可能是由于以下原因导致的:
- 应用程序配置错误:请确保在CloudHub控制台中正确配置了应用程序的相关参数,例如API接口的监听端口、协议等。
- 应用程序健康检查失败:CloudHub会定期进行健康检查,以确保应用程序正常运行。如果应用程序的健康检查失败,CloudHub将停止接收流量并返回502错误。请检查应用程序的健康检查配置,确保应用程序能够正常响应。
- 配额限制:CloudHub可能对每个部署实例的资源和连接数有限制。如果超过了限制,可能会导致502错误。请确保你的应用程序的资源使用量未超过CloudHub的限制。
- 网络问题:502错误也可能是由于网络连接问题导致的。请检查网络连接是否正常,包括云服务提供商的网络连接以及你的应用程序的网络配置。
解决502错误的方法包括:
- 检查应用程序配置:仔细检查应用程序在CloudHub控制台中的配置,确保配置正确无误。
- 检查应用程序健康检查:确保应用程序的健康检查配置正确,并能够正常响应。
- 联系云服务提供商支持:如果问题持续存在,可以联系MuleSoft的技术支持团队,寻求进一步的帮助和解决方案。
对于部署在CloudHub上的应用程序,推荐使用MuleSoft提供的其他相关产品,如Anypoint Platform,以提供全面的集成和管理能力。你可以参考腾讯云的云计算产品文档,了解更多关于CloudHub的详细信息和使用方法:腾讯云云计算产品文档-CloudHub。请注意,这里提供的是腾讯云的相关产品链接,仅作为参考,不代表其他流行云计算品牌商。